Output 51e216a80f9850db641bb024e82947342ddf8a4c891aae06d678f60904be3c61:1

value
2869976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e495af9790bb1619979e3c67655af6af030b3cf1 OP_EQUALVERIFY OP_CHECKSIG
address
1MqeP6bSttJp8Gd6rQJEei4XTxkR6gWNpa
transaction
51e216a80f9850db641bb024e82947342ddf8a4c891aae06d678f60904be3c61
spent
true